1. The Robe of Righteousness
The Bible speaks of being clothed in righteousness, a concept that transcends physical attire to encompass the moral and spiritual fabric of our being. In Isaiah 61:10, it is written, “I delight greatly in the Lord; my soul rejoices in my God. For he has clothed me with garments of salvation and arrayed me in a robe of his righteousness, as a bridegroom adorns his head like a priest, and as a bride adorns herself with her jewels.” This robe of righteousness is not something we earn but is bestowed upon us through our faith and acceptance of God’s grace. Wearing this robe symbolically means embracing a life of integrity, justice, and compassion, which are foundational elements in the pursuit of inner peace.
2. The Armor of God
In Ephesians 6:10-18, the Apostle Paul writes about the armor of God, which believers are to put on to stand against the devil’s schemes. This armor includes the belt of truth, the breastplate of righteousness, the feet fitted with the readiness that comes from the gospel of peace, the shield of faith, the helmet of salvation, and the sword of the Spirit, which is the Word of God. Each piece of this armor represents a vital aspect of our spiritual defense and offense, equipping us to face life’s challenges with confidence and peace, knowing we are protected and empowered by God.
3. Garments of Praise
The Bible encourages believers to wear garments of praise instead of a spirit of despair (Isaiah 61:3). Praise is an act of worship that acknowledges God’s presence, power, and goodness in our lives. By choosing to praise God, even in the darkest of times, we put on a spiritual garment that lifts our spirits, shifts our perspective, and brings us closer to experiencing inner peace. It’s an active choice to focus on the positive, to trust in God’s sovereignty, and to express gratitude for all things.
4. The cloak of Humility
In Colossians 3:12, believers are exhorted to clothe themselves with compassion, kindness, humility, gentleness, and patience. The cloak of humility is particularly noteworthy as it involves recognizing our limitations and our dependence on God. Humility allows us to let go of pride and self-reliance, embracing a simpler, more authentic way of living that is not encumbered by the need for self-justification or external validation. This humility opens the door to deeper relationships with others and with God, fostering an environment of peace and understanding.
5. The Mantle of Wisdom
The book of Proverbs is filled with wisdom on how to live a virtuous and peaceful life. One of the keys to attaining inner peace is seeking and applying wisdom. In Proverbs 31:25, the virtuous woman is described as being clothed with strength and dignity, and she laughs without fear of the future. This strength and dignity come from wisdom, which guides our decisions, actions, and reactions, leading us on a path of integrity and peace.
6. The Garment of Forgiveness
Forgiveness is a powerful garment that we are encouraged to wear. In Matthew 6:14-15, Jesus teaches that if we forgive those who sin against us, our heavenly Father will forgive us. But if we do not forgive those who sin against us, our Father will not forgive us. Forgiveness is a spiritual garment that frees us from the burden of resentment and anger, allowing us to walk in peace and liberty. It’s a choice that reflects God’s grace towards us and opens the way for healing and reconciliation.
7. The White Garments of Purity
Revelation 3:18 advises believers to buy from God gold refined in the fire, so they can become rich, and white clothes to wear, so they can cover their shameful nakedness. The white garments symbolize purity and righteousness, which are the fruits of a deep, abiding relationship with God. Pursuing purity of heart and mind leads to a clarity of purpose and a sense of peace that comes from knowing one is living in accordance with divine principles and values.
